Skilled workers treat this problem using the trial-and-error method so far. In this paper, a theoretical method for cutting hypoid pinion under consideration of tooth surface modification is proposed. The method is based on the theory of basic member. The non-generating ring gear is cut by Gleason's Formate method. The pinion is generated by a newly introduced quasi-basic member whose tooth (tool) surface is a conventional conical surface. The quasi-basic member is a substitute tool gear for the basic member which is an imaginary gear generated by a ring gear. The tool surface of the quasi-basic member is in contact with the imaginary generated tooth surface of the basic member at a point, and envelops the imaginary surface in tool material side. There is a small clearance between the two surfaces. This clearance modifies the pinion tooth surface.
